    REPLACE Thermostat?
    Is there any trick to replacing a defunct thermostat? The clock on my old Honeywell Chromotherm has stopped functioning and the mechanism may be obsolete. If I need to replace the whole unit, is it necessary to cut off the electricity leading to the thermostat?

    Turn off power to the inside unit.

    Mark down each color of wire and where the wire landed on the old thermostat W,R,Y,G,etc.

    Buy new thermostat and follow the directions EXACTLY.

    You should be OK.

    NOTE do not forget to identify/mark/write down/ where the old wires were on the old thermostat.

    You would not believe that most people do not follow the directions and do not identify the wires before removal.
